Every Painting Estimating Services package for Wake County includes: Painting Material & Labor Takeoff Workbook in Microsoft Excel with paint gallon conversions, Color-Coded Vector PDF Markup Set indicating coating zones, paint sheens, and accent walls, Paint gallon consumption estimate based on manufacturer coverage spread rates (350–400 SF/gal), Surface preparation and specialized high-performance coating schedule. All deliverables are calibrated using North Carolina-indexed material supplier quotations and localized labor wage databases.

Key scope inclusions: Interior walls and ceilings: primer plus two coats latex or low-VOC acrylic paint; Exposed overhead structure: dryfall paint on steel deck, trusses, ductwork, and conduit; Door and frame coatings: acrylic enamel or industrial polyurethane on hollow metal doors; Exterior painting: elastomeric masonry coatings, acrylic exterior paint, and metal primers. Documented exclusions clarifying bid boundaries: Lead-based paint hazardous abatement removal (specialty environmental scope); Drywall taping and skim coating (covered under drywall scope).
